My OBS is running into an infuriating bug where every time I enter into a game from my Display Capture it immediately goes invisible.

Rage 2 works fine in my monitor but doesn't show up on my OBS even though I'm using Display Capture. This is the same for other games like Rocket League, Borderlands 2 and Mordhau etc etc

I'm using a single desktop setup have updated the GPU driver, as well as done all the Windows updates, disabled the Windows gaming sessions and also disabled the Nvidia in game overlay.

It's driving me up the wall as there's just no rhyme or reason to it and I can't stream.

Suggest setting up a fresh profile/scene collection and a single scene with JUST a display capture in it to see if that is also broken. From the logfile it looks like your in-game scene contains an embedded scene with a display capture that has a 3rd party 3D transform filter from stream effects, and I wonder if that has broken or if it is something else.

Does game capture not work either?

Game capture does not work. Windows capture does but as soon as I click into the monitor that has the game it freezes the game on a single frame in OBS. When I click out of the window to another monitor the game works perfectly again and doesn't stay on that frame anymore. It's so weird.

I'll try your method now of new profile and scene with display capture.

EDIT: You're right! It seems as though when I make a new profile and a new scene collection it works perfectly. So maybe the transform is the problem?
